How Citywide Delivers
Security That Fits the Building and the People Using It
Corporate and residential properties need officers who can protect the premises while communicating confidently with tenants, residents, visitors, contractors and facilities teams. Citywide defines the role around the building’s access system, operating hours, shared spaces, management expectations and emergency procedures.
The service can combine lobby presence, internal and external patrols, visitor management, incident support and out-of-hours cover. Where the site needs a more hospitality-led approach, concierge security or reception security can be incorporated into the wider guarding plan.
A Role Defined Around the Property
Office buildings, apartment blocks and mixed-use developments have different rules for visitors, deliveries, amenities, contractors and restricted areas. We document those expectations so the officer understands the balance between access control, assistance and escalation.
Professional Communication at Every Contact Point
The officer may be the first person a visitor or resident approaches. Selection therefore considers presentation, communication, judgement and the ability to remain calm during complaints, emergencies or unauthorised-access incidents.
Reporting for Facilities and Property Managers
Daily logs, patrol observations, contractor records, key events and incident reports provide management with a consistent record. Handover procedures help ensure that unresolved concerns are carried into the next shift rather than lost between officers.
